Description
A comprehensive review of this restaurant reveals mixed feelings from customers. While some found the food bland and disappointing in terms of portion size, others praised the breakfast options and tacos. The service received mixed reviews, with some patrons feeling like they were treated rudely while others appreciated the friendly staff and great service. The atmosphere of the restaurant was also a point of contention, with some enjoying the cozy, hole-in-the-wall vibe while others found it lacking. Overall, opinions on this restaurant vary, with some recommending it as a must-visit spot in Boerne and others suggesting trying options across the street.

It 's a hole-in-the-wall taco joint (in a good way). Just like any of the breakfast taco places in town, it 's a local hang-out. Space is tight, so you 'll get to know your neighbors. Be prepared to wait outside for a bit on busier days. Check their days/hours of operation so you don 't miss 'em.
